Smart Climate Sensors
Smart climate sensing units have revolutionized the performance of modern watering systems by readjusting sprinkling schedules based on real-time ecological information. These sensing units check variables such as temperature level, humidity, wind rate, and solar radiation, enabling systems to react dynamically to transforming weather. By incorporating this information, wise sensing units can maximize water usage, lowering waste and making sure that landscapes obtain the suitable quantity of dampness. This innovation not just preserves water but likewise advertises much healthier plant growth by stopping overwatering or underwatering. Furthermore, the automation supplied by smart weather sensors improves individual benefit, as home owners and landscapers can count on accurate watering routines without hands-on intervention. Generally, these technologies represent a considerable development in lasting watering practices.

Soil Moisture Sensors
Soil moisture sensing units play an important duty in modern irrigation systems, providing real-time data that boosts water efficiency. These devices determine the volumetric water content in the dirt, permitting specific evaluations of wetness degrees. By incorporating soil wetness sensing units into irrigation systems, individuals can prevent overwatering or underwatering, ultimately promoting much healthier plant development and saving water resources.The sensors send information to controllers, which can adjust watering routines based upon present dirt problems. This data-driven technique reduces water waste and assurances that plants receive the finest amount of wetness. Additionally, dirt dampness sensing units can be advantageous in different farming settings, from home gardens to large-scale farms. The deployment of these sensing units contributes to lasting methods by sustaining liable water use and lowering environmental effect. On the whole, the consolidation of soil wetness sensing units marks a substantial improvement in attaining effective irrigation systems.

What Is the Life Expectancy of Modern Automatic Sprinkler Elements?
The life expectancy of modern sprinkler system elements normally ranges from 5 to 20 years, depending upon the materials made use of, maintenance practices, and environmental conditions. Routine maintenance can considerably boost durability and efficiency with time.
